Today, Congresswoman Deborah Ross (NC-02) released the following statement as President Trump imposes tariffs on Canada and China, and temporarily pauses new tariffs on imports from Mexico:

“Costs are still too high, and President Trump should make good on his campaign promises and prioritize bringing them down. Instead, he imposed steep duties on products from our closest allies, increasing the price of energy, medicine, groceries, and everyday goods. While I’m glad that he subsequently decided to pause tariffs on Mexico, I’m still extremely concerned about his decision to penalize Canada and about the possibility of future tariffs on our other major trading partners.”

“To be clear – I support actions that lower costs and create American jobs. But the President’s rash moves won’t have either effect. Instead, he is alienating our allies and hurting households and businesses, both here in the Triangle and across the country. I join business leaders from a range of industries in urging President Trump to reverse this terrible plan before more Americans suffer the consequences.”
